Updated: January 2, 2026 9:59am

Prism Users Guide - Chapter 31. Centrals
31.8 Centrals Resiliency Service

About the Centrals Resiliency Service
Even the most reliable Internet connections may occasionally suffer a loss of connectivity. For merchants, even a brief interruption in the connection with the server can result in significant losses. RP Prism Centrals includes an offline mode to gracefully handle situations in which the connection to the Centrals server is lost.
When the connection to the Centrals server is lost, RP Prism will continue to allow you to make transactions. In the case of Central Credit, you can define an Offline Take Limit that places a ceiling on the amount for any single offline transaction. When the connection is restored, transactions completed when the centrals server was offline are sent to the Centrals Server.
Offline mode' is defined as ‘Centrals Service not available'. This could be caused by a variety of problems, including:

  • The Centrals hostname/IP address was entered incorrectly and cannot be found
  • The Centrals server is down
  • The Centrals Server is up, but the PrismPOSV1 service on the Centrals server is not running. 

The frequency with which resiliency tries to re-connect to the Centrals server is the ‘Interval' value (in minutes) defined in Admin Console > Installation Defaults. Enter the number of minutes Prism should wait before checking again to see if the connection to the Centrals server has been restored. For example, entering a value of 5 means that a check will be done every five minutes until the connection is restored.
PrismResiliencyService.exe
The Prism Server Installer adds the PrismResiliencyServer.exe to the file system and installs the PrismResiliencyService in the "C:\Program Files (x86)\RetailPro\Resiliency" folder. The PrismResiliencyService.exe facilitates the ability to create Central Credit and Central Gift Card transactions while offline. The Resiliency service will run automatically according to the Interval defined in Installation Defaults. You can run the service outside of the interval by clicking the "Run Resiliency" button. 

Prism Centrals Resiliency Settings
In Admin Console > Node Preferences > Transactions > Centrals, the Central Server Settings area has a button to start the Resiliency Service. The interface includes various read-only fields that display status and other resiliency-related information.

Preference Description
Service State The current state of the service: Active or Sleeping
Last Cycle Displays the date/time of the last connection and the status of the connection.
Status of Last Cycle Displays the number of offline transactions or the message "No Offline Transactions Found".
Next Cycle Displays the date/time of the next scheduled check of the resiliency connection.
Run Resiliency Click the Run Resiliency button to immediately start the Resiliency connection process (otherwise, the Resiliency service runs automatically according to the Interval defined in Installation Defaults).


Basic Steps for Centrals Resiliency
1.    If using Central Credit, define an Offline Take Limit in Node Preferences > Transactions > Centrals.
2.    Perform transactions as usual. If the connection with the server is lost, a message will be displayed in the UI.
3.    When your connection is restored, Prism will send the offline transactions to the Centrals server.

Central Customer Lookup in Offline Mode
When the connection to the centrals server is offline, Central customer lookup will call out to the centrals server to retrieve the customer. When the timeout expires, a prompt is displayed asking if the local database should be checked.

Central Returns in Offline Mode
When the connection to the centrals server is offline, if a user does a central return, Prism will first check the Centrals server for the original transaction. After the number of seconds specified in the Timeout setting, a prompt is displayed. The user has three options:

  • Retry: Click the Retry button to search the Centrals server again
  • Local: Click the Local button to search the local database.
  • Cancel: Click the Cancel button to cancel the search

If the transaction is found on the Centrals server or local database, the return can proceed.

Central Credit in Offline Mode
When the connection to the centrals server is offline and a customer is entered on a transaction, Prism will first check the Centrals server. After the number of seconds defined in the Timeout setting, Prism will pull the last-known Centrals Credit balance for the customer in the local database. Under the customer's name on the transaction form will be an indication that Central Credit is offline. The user can do an Add Value or Redeem transaction up to the "Max Amount" defined in Node Preferences > Transaction > Centrals. 
Important! Centrals Credit lookup by Credit ID is not functional in Offline mode, only lookup by customer.

Centrals Gift Cards in Offline Mode
Only purchase (activation) of gift cards is allowed. Redemption and balance check is not allowed.
Offline Messages
During Central Customer Lookup, if the Centrals server cannot be reached, when the number of seconds specified in the Timeout value have elapsed, a message is displayed: "Centrals Server is Offline: Local results will be displayed"
If the Centrals server cannot be reached, or the entered username or password is incorrect, a message is displayed: "Centrals Server not Connected"
In POS, when ‘offline', the line underneath the listed customer that indicates the Centrals Credit balance will show ‘(Offline)' 
On the Tender screen, when Offline, the Centrals Credit Tender chosen will show ‘(Offline)'.